GLBT advertising awards (USA)
04 August 2008
The Commercial Closet Association (US) last Monday, at the 4th Images In Advertising Awards, honoured companies that best demonstrated inclusion of gay, lesbian, bisexual, and transgender (GLBT) individuals in print, TV and internet advertising campaigns over the past year.

The top honour for outstanding commercial was Levi’s Jeans. Other top winners included Switzerland Tourism, BMW, General Motors, Paris Tourism & IKEA. The winning advertisements can be viewed at

South Australia’s Blaze publication under new management
07 July 2008
Evolution Publishing, Australia’s leading gay and lesbian publishing house, publishers of SX, MCV, Queensland Pride, AXN, Cherrie and Fellow Traveller has acquired South Australia’s fortnightly gay, lesbian, transgender, bi-sexual and queer (GLTBQ) lifestyle publication, Blaze.
With Blaze part of the Evolution Publishing stable, advertisers are now offered a true one-stop shop when targeting the GLTBQ communities, whether in the major capital cities or Australia-wide.
Evolution Publishing titles are distributed free to street via more than 2,400 cafes, bars, nightclubs, hotels, book stores, art venues, theatres, cinemas, education centres and libraries throughout Australia. With a combined readership of over 10.4 million readers annually there is no better way to reach the GLTBQ community.

Tourism Ireland wins award promoting Ireland to Gay & Lesbian travellers

Advertisers in the 2007 Mardi Gras guide were called upon to "make their ads a little bit naughty, cheeky and a little bit kooky”. Tourism Ireland was the winner for the most creative ad using an image of a rainbow flag with a pun on the word 'Gaelic' which became “Gaylic…your very own Ireland”.
